A crowd of people protesting has formed outside a Midlothian property for the fourth night in the space of a week.

Around 40 people reportedly gathered in St Andrew Street in Dalkeith at around 5.30pm on Tuesday, August 4. Those demonstrating claimed they were opposing an alleged “sex offender” who had been housed in the area.

Police were again in attendance, with several officers seen trying to control the crowd. A cordon also appeared to have been erected outside a boarded-up flat.

Edinburgh Live previously reported on the earlier demonstrations, which were dispersed by police with no arrests made.

In footage shared on social media, those outside could be heard shouting and chanting, calling for the person inside the property to be removed.

A significant police presence could be seen swarming the residential street.
